High Fiber Savory Waffles
Serves 3
INGREDIENTS
- coconut cooking spray
- 1 & 1/2 cups organic wheat bran
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 4 eggs
- 3/4 cup unsweetened nut milk + more if needed
- 3 tbsp chives, chopped
- pinch of sea salt
Optional Toppings:
- vegan cream cheese, I used Monty’s
- cherry tomatoes, sliced
- smoked salmon
- za’atar
- chives
- capers
- dill
- lemon
DIRECTIONS
- STEP 1. Preheat waffle iron and lightly grease with cooking spray.
- STEP 2. Mix all of the ingredients in a bowl until well combined. Add more nut milk if needed. It shouldn’t be too much liquid but the consistency of a batter.
- STEP 3. Pour some of the mixture into the waffle iron and close. Cook until the light goes off so you know it is ready, the waffles should look golden. Repeat this step two more times so you make three waffles total.
- STEP 4. Serve waffles and top with your favorite toppings.
